LE JOURNAL DES SÇAVANS...Par le Sieur de Hedouville. Volumes I-II (5 January-30 March 1665 [complete]; and 4 January-20 December 1666). Paris, 1665-66. 2 volumes bound in one, 4to, contemporary vellum; second volume with pages 71-74 misbound after page 82, and lacking pages 95-98 and 419-31. Engraved folding plate and other text illustrations.

The second volume contains a review of Hooke's Micrographia (with folding plate) on pages 491-97. "Founded and edited by 'Sieur de Hédouville', pseudonym of Denis de Sallo (1626-1669), the Journal des Sçavans was 'the earliest scientific journal, ancestor of all its kind'."--Grolier/Horblit 95a.
